News Topical, Digital Desk : A 17-year-old minor was stabbed to death in the Siraspur area of ​​Delhi's Outer North district. The Delhi Police solved the case in just four hours. Five accused, including a minor, have been arrested in this sensational crime. The police have also recovered the knife used in the murder.

The accused committed the crime on January 21. 

According to Delhi Police, the incident occurred around 7:30 pm on January 21, 2026. The deceased youth was sitting with his friends near a bonfire in Rana Park, Siraspur. A group of six or seven young men approached and, without any provocation, began a physical altercation. The fight quickly escalated, and three of the attackers pulled out knives.

It is reported that the deceased defended himself from the attacks of two attackers, but the third accused stabbed him deeply between the ribs on the left side of his chest. His friends immediately rushed the seriously injured young man to Babasaheb Ambedkar Hospital, where doctors pronounced him dead.

Delhi Police caught the accused through technical surveillance and CCTV

As soon as the Delhi Police received information about the incident, a crime team arrived at the scene. An FIR was registered, CCTV footage was examined, and the accused's mobile phones were also technically examined. Subsequently, raids were conducted throughout the night in various areas of Delhi and the five accused were apprehended.

The arrested accused have been identified as Ajay alias Bindi, Sunny alias Bhatura, Suraj, Raju alias Bengali, and a minor. According to the police, one of the accused has previous criminal involvement. Police are currently searching for the remaining weapons and other individuals involved in the crime.
